远程连接telnet和ssh的区别?(telnet如何连接)
[root@web01 ~]# ssh root@172.16.1.31 -p 22
#命令拆分
ssh #命令
root #系统用户(如果不写,就使用当前服务器的当前用户)
@ #分隔符
172.16.1.31 #远程主机的IP
-p #指定端口(终端不支持)
22 #端口(默认22)
-o StrictHostKeyChecking=no #首次访问时不验证身份
那么为什么都用ssh连接而不用telnet链接呢?
两者的区别
1.telnet:
1)不能使用root用户登录,只能使用普通用户
2)数据包没有进行加密,传输都是明文的
2.ssh
1)可以使用任意用户登录
2)数据传输都是加密的
本文来自博客园,作者:六月OvO,转载请注明原文链接:https://www.cnblogs.com/chenlifan/p/13519714.html